About the Position

The Forklift Operator / Clamp Operator is responsible for the safe and efficient operation of Powered Industrial Equipment.

The Forklift Operator / Clamp Operator is responsible for utilizing the lift equipment to move, load, unload, and stack products in preparation for shipping and receiving demands to meet customer needs.

Functions

  • Safely operate Powered Industrial equipment to move products or materials for distribution such as reach, slip sheet, push / pull equipment, and drive-in pallet racking.
  • Load, unload, and store products and / or materials
  • Stack and / or transport materials and products to designated areas.
  • Use equipment to scan product and print labels.
  • Complete paperwork and operate inventory management systems as needed.
  • Ensure product rotation procedures are followed.
  • Complete cycle count as required
  • Perform daily safely inspections per the Safety Checklist on forklift trucks
  • Ensure facility is inspection ready at all times for SQFI, FDA, and customer needs.
  • Communicate and report any incidents to supervisor.
  • May perform housekeeping duties
  • Miscellaneous tasks as assigned by Supervisor

Qualifications

  • Minimum two years prior forklift operating experience. Must be a licensed forklift operator or be able to obtain a Forklift Operator license.
  • High School Diploma or equivalent preferred.
  • Pass Background and Drug screen
  • Basic computer skills
  • Attention to detail
